I just saw Indiana Jones 4. It was okay, actually! I was afraid with Lucas' track record he was going to ruin it...like another trilogy I know. Ford was charming despite being around 60, he and Karen Allen were great together, and Shia LeBoeuf (or however you spell his last name) was perfect as always. The chase scenes were a little long, and I think the movie could have benefited from a lot of...plot...but it was entertaining, funny, and worth the matinee price.
On the normal scale of 10, If Raiders of the Lost Ark is a 10, The Last Crusade a 9, Temple of Doom an 8, Crystal Skull is a 7.
On my PERSONAL scale of 4 stars, rating watchibility only, Crystal skull is a 3. A 4 movie can be watched over and over again without losing whatever the heck made you love it in the first place, and a 1 a movie that made you gag and you'll never watch it again--even if it was a great movie (such as the Killing Fields. 10/10, but also 1/4!).

Anyways, my sister rented Sweeney Todd for me the other day. I LOVE musicals, right? I really do. King and I, My Fair Lady, Kiss Me Kate--these are some of my favorite movies ever. I HATED Sweeney Todd. I thought it was the most disgusting and depressing movies ever. Granted, it was probably supposed to be that way! But there was no redeeming qualities to it at all! I don't mind dark movies (I loved del Toro's Labyrinth), I don't mind depressing movies (Empire of the Sun), but when there is NO let up...sheesh!
Gets a 8/10 for how it was made, the lyrics, acting and production, but it gets a 0/4 on my scale of watchability!

I just got back from seeing Kung Fu Panda. OMG, it was GREAT. I expected it to be okay, but if you're a martial arts aficionado like myself, it is not only endlessly hilarious, but wonderful fun.
....though, there did seem to be some confusion with names. "Shifu" (N. China title for "Sifu" or "Master") was the NAME of a character. The Sigung (Sifu of a sifu) never calls his student "Shifu.' Eh, but most people would never catch that. It was just a little odd.
Really great animation though. Gets a 4/4 for my personal scale of watchability, and a 9/10 on the normal scale. Some stuff was just a TAD too silly, but then again, it's a kids' movie!
